IDataParameter.SourceVersion Properti
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mendapatkan atau mengatur DataRowVersion untuk digunakan saat memuat Value.
public:
property System::Data::DataRowVersion SourceVersion { System::Data::DataRowVersion get(); void set(System::Data::DataRowVersion value); };
public System.Data.DataRowVersion SourceVersion { get; set; }
member this.SourceVersion : System.Data.DataRowVersion with get, set
Public Property SourceVersion As DataRowVersion
Nilai Properti
Salah DataRowVersion satu nilai. Default adalah Current
.
Pengecualian
Properti tidak diatur salah DataRowVersion satu nilai.
Contoh
Contoh berikut membuat instans kelas penerapan, SqlParameter, dan menetapkan beberapa propertinya.
public void CreateSqlParameter()
{
SqlParameter parameter = new SqlParameter(
"@Description", SqlDbType.VarChar);
parameter.IsNullable = true;
parameter.SourceColumn = "Description";
parameter.SourceVersion = DataRowVersion.Current;
parameter.Direction = ParameterDirection.Output;
}
Public Sub CreateSqlParameter()
Dim parameter As New SqlParameter( _
"@Description", SqlDbType.VarChar)
parameter.IsNullable = True
parameter.SourceColumn = "Description"
parameter.SourceVersion = DataRowVersion.Current
parameter.Direction = ParameterDirection.Output
End Sub
Keterangan
Properti ini digunakan oleh UpdateCommand selama Update untuk menentukan apakah nilai asli atau saat ini digunakan untuk nilai parameter. Ini memungkinkan kunci primer diperbarui. Properti ini diabaikan oleh InsertCommand dan DeleteCommand. Properti ini diatur ke versi yang DataRow digunakan oleh Item[] properti , atau GetChildRows metode DataRow objek .